offer up
英 [ˈɒfə(r) ʌp]
美 [ˈɔːfər ʌp]
(向上帝或神)奉献(祈祷、赞美),祭献(牺牲)
柯林斯词典
- → see:offer 6
英英释义
verb
- present as an act of worship
- offer prayers to the gods
